Item2的使用

网址:http://wulfric.me/2015/08/iterm2/

巧用 Command 键

按住?键:

  • 可以拖拽选中的字符串;
  • 点击 url:调用默认浏览器访问该网址;
  • 点击文件:调用默认程序打开文件;
  • 如果文件名是filename:42,且默认文本编辑器是 Macvim、Textmate或BBEdit,将会直接打开到这一行;
  • 点击文件夹:在 finder 中打开该文件夹;
  • 同时按住option键,可以以矩形选中,类似于vim中的ctrl v操作。
  • 常用快捷键

    • 切换 tab:?+←, ?+→, ?+{, ?+}。?+数字直接定位到该 tab;
    • 新建 tab:?+t;
    • 顺序切换 pane:?+[, ?+];
    • 按方向切换 pane:?+Option+方向键;
    • 切分屏幕:?+d 水平切分,?+Shift+d 垂直切分;
    • 智能查找,支持正则查找:?+f。
      • 在用户目录下有个隐藏文件 .bash.profile  中加

        export CLICOLOR=1

        export LSCOLORS=gxfxcxdxbxegedabagacad

        export PS1=‘\[\033[01;32m\]\[email protected]\h\[\033[00m\]:\[\033[01;36m\]\w\[\033[00m\]\$‘

        export TERM=xterm-color

        这样就可以多色彩

时间: 2024-08-29 19:47:40

Item2的使用的相关文章

Mac下终端配置(item2 + oh-my-zsh + solarized配色方案)

转载自:http://www.cnblogs.com/weixuqin/p/7029177.html 安装 首先我们下载的 iTem2 这个软件,比Mac自带的终端更加强大.直接官网 http://iterm2.com/ 下载并安装即可. 配置 将iTem2设置为默认终端: (菜单栏)iTerm2 -> Make iTerm2 Default Term 然后打开偏好设置preference,选中Keys,勾选Hotkey下的Show/hide iTerm2 with a system-wide

Effective Java Item2:Consider a builder when faced with many constructor parameters

Item2:Consider a builder when faced with many constructor parameters 当构造方法有多个参数时,可以考虑使用builder方式进行处理. 实例代码: public class NutritionFacts { private final int servingSize; private final int servings; private final int calories; private final int fat; pr

mac item2 ssh

一.常规ssh登录流程 ssh登陆有三个参数,主机名,用户名,用户密码,流程都是一样. 1.ssh 用户名@主机名 2.返回包含(yes/no)的字符串,此时输入 “yes" 3.然后再返回 ”password:",此时输入 用户密码. 登陆完成. 二. 我们可以自己写一个脚本,收集主机名,用户名,用户密码这三个参数,然后自动把后面的完成. shell脚本如下: #!/usr/bin/expect set timeout 60 spawn ssh [lindex $argv 0]@[l

mac 安装item2 lrzsz

1.先安装item2,item2 市类似mac风格的终端      item2 下载地址,http://iterm2.com/downloads.html,下载后解压缩就能运行 2.Install Homebrew      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)" 3.使用brew 安装lrzsz     brew install lrzsz   

macOS(Mojave10.14.1)安装brew、iTem2、oh-my-zsh套件

brew安装 brew是一个软件包管理工具,类似于centos下的yum或者ubuntu下的apt-get,非常方便,免去了自己手动编译安装的不便 brew 安装目录 /usr/local/Cellar brew 配置目录 /usr/local/etc brew 命令目录 /usr/local/bin 执行命令: /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/ins

macos Item2 添加 Shell Integration (ftp传输)

macos系统 的item2软件 的  Shell Integration (ftp传输)  功能强大,无需 安装其他ftp软件,也是为了保证 密码安全 在使用时报错如下(因为本地 ping不通): Failed to connect to xxxxxx:22. Double-check that the host name is correct. 安装步骤: 1.在本机 和 需要传输的 服务器 安装 如下命令: curl -L https://iterm2.com/shell_integrat

item2

一.简介 iTerm2 是 OS X 下一款开源免费的的终端工具,很多人基本用它替代了原生的 Terminal. 二.特色功能 https://www.zhihu.com/question/27447370

第二章:创建和销毁对象。ITEM2:遇到多个构造器参数时要考虑用构建器。

如果一个类中有大量的可选参数,有以下几种方式: 1.重叠构造器: package com.twoslow.cha2; /** * 重叠构造器可行,但是当由许多参数的时候,客户端代码很难编写. * @author sai * */ public class Item201 { private final int servingSize; private final int servings; private final int calories; private final int fat; pr

item2,实现singleton模式

单例模式? 只能实现一个实例的类成为单例. ============== muduo库中单例模式实现 #include<boost/noncopyable.hpp> //#include "../sort.h" //#include "getLeastNumber.h" #include<set> using namespace std; template<typename T> class Singleton:boost::no

经典阅读-《Effective C++》Item2:尽量以const,enum,inline替换#define

1. 宏定义 #define ASPECT_RATIO 1.653 该宏定义ASPECT_RATIO也许从来没有被编译器看到,也许在编译器开始处理源码之前就已经被预处理器替换了.所以记号名称ASPECT_RATIO有可能没进入符号表(symbol table)中.所以,当你从这个常量得到一个编译错误信息时,这个错误信息可能会提到1.653而不是ASPECT_RATIO,如果这个ASPECT_RATIO被定义在一个非你写的头文件中,那么调试追踪这个错误更是麻烦.在调试阶段,visual stidu